diff options
Diffstat (limited to 'spec/javascripts/dashboard_spec.js.es6')
-rw-r--r-- | spec/javascripts/dashboard_spec.js.es6 | 37 |
1 files changed, 0 insertions, 37 deletions
diff --git a/spec/javascripts/dashboard_spec.js.es6 b/spec/javascripts/dashboard_spec.js.es6 deleted file mode 100644 index c0bdb89ed63..00000000000 --- a/spec/javascripts/dashboard_spec.js.es6 +++ /dev/null @@ -1,37 +0,0 @@ -/* eslint-disable no-new */ - -require('~/sidebar'); -require('~/lib/utils/text_utility'); - -((global) => { - describe('Dashboard', () => { - const fixtureTemplate = 'static/dashboard.html.raw'; - - function todosCountText() { - return $('.js-todos-count').text(); - } - - function triggerToggle(newCount) { - $(document).trigger('todo:toggle', newCount); - } - - preloadFixtures(fixtureTemplate); - beforeEach(() => { - loadFixtures(fixtureTemplate); - new global.Sidebar(); - }); - - it('should update todos-count after receiving the todo:toggle event', () => { - triggerToggle(5); - expect(todosCountText()).toEqual('5'); - }); - - it('should display todos-count with delimiter', () => { - triggerToggle(1000); - expect(todosCountText()).toEqual('1,000'); - - triggerToggle(1000000); - expect(todosCountText()).toEqual('1,000,000'); - }); - }); -})(window.gl); |